Delve into the fascinating world of Behavioural Economics, a comprehensive exploration of how psychological insights intersect with economic theory. Authored by Michelle, a distinguished Professor in Economics and Finance of the Built Environment at University College London, this book offers a nuanced perspective on the decision-making processes of individuals and institutions.
In this insightful text, Michelle examines the underlying motivations that drive economic behaviour, challenging traditional economic models that often assume rationality. Through a blend of theoretical frameworks and real-world applications, readers are invited to consider how cognitive biases, emotions, and social influences shape economic choices. The book navigates through topics such as consumer behaviour, market dynamics, and policy implications, providing a holistic view of the field.
This book is ideal for students, academics, and anyone interested in understanding the psychological factors that influence economic decisions. Whether you are new to the subject or seeking to deepen your knowledge, Behavioural Economics serves as an essential resource. It complements other works by Michelle, expanding the dialogue on the intersection of economics and human behaviour.
